How much HP can a 4L80 handle? Will a 4L80E handle 500hp? The 4L80E in stock form would be limited by it’s direct clutches (3rd gear) and that would be a part that would gradually fail at ~500 HP if raced often but last years on the street at closer to 600 HP/TQ in a passenger car application.

The torque converter on this automatic transmission is a fluid turbine drive, much like those found on its predecessors, e.g., the 700R4, 4L60, TH350C. The 4L80E also comes with a lock-up pressure plate for direct, mechanically-coupled driving from the engine crank. In '03 the stock Duramax advertised torque was 520 ft/lbs at 1,800 RPM. The torque curve was flat all the way to the 3,000 redline. The Allison could only handle an additional 100HP gain safely, thus the $5,000 figure when one was adding serious HP. This is all based on my '03, the newer engines put out significantly more HP and torque.
